Output 44b15557416b93d79f2f8ac725253e6ed305c0aa8500035115c04e33435e6f8e:0

value
975895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0552f24151fadae34f5995f118cd0ce17655cb4a OP_EQUAL
address
32BAfiLV9WzzTwLPw6m3eRGZoWtuUozKk4
transaction
44b15557416b93d79f2f8ac725253e6ed305c0aa8500035115c04e33435e6f8e
spent
true